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9053240389 3570 35627642
211157 56
211157 56
456025382 306 1949137843
All about undefined
Interested in learning more?
211157 56
456025382 306 1949137843
See more
6004 84244 20972904166
1702 28 6676 81113449
See more
33535 8515451
5007401 5787037160 992 253613
See more